Bug Description

Marlin crashes when I press some navigation button (i. e. down arrow) and returns Segmentation fults.
I have this bug in last (790) revision in 64-bit Archlinux.

I was able to reproduce this in Ubuntu 11.10 32-bit on April 9, 2012 at 16:00 UTC. Pressing any of the navigation buttons in an empty folder causes segmentation faults.
